Fulham Acquire Armando Broja on Loan from Chelsea

Fulham Football Club has bolstered its attacking options by securing the services of Armando Broja on a season-long loan from cross-city rivals Chelsea. The 22-year-old's move comes amidst keen interest from other clubs and adds potential firepower to Fulham's lineup for the remainder of the campaign.

A Season of Promise for Broja

Despite a challenging season that included a significant injury setback, Broja has managed to find the net twice in 19 outings for Chelsea. His contributions to the Blues' squad have been notable, and he now looks to extend his impact at Craven Cottage. His talent has not gone unnoticed internationally, as Broja also stands out as a prominent member of the Albania national team.

Moreover, Broja's market value was highlighted as he garnered attention from other notable clubs. Wolverhampton Wanderers and Italian giants AC Milan expressed interest in acquiring his services during the winter transfer window, ultimately making Fulham's successful negotiation a statement of intent for the club's ambitions.

Overcoming Injury and Building a Career

Broja's young career has not been devoid of challenges; he missed a substantial part of the 2022-23 season due to a ruptured anterior cruciate ligament, an injury notorious for its difficulty to rehabilitate from. However, his resilience is evident as he steps into Fulham's fold, aiming to contribute further in the Premier League.

Having emerged from Chelsea's esteemed academy, Broja's pedigree is clear, with his tenure at Chelsea accounting for 38 appearances and three goals since 2020. As he continues his development, this loan could prove pivotal in defining his trajectory in top-flight English football.

Chelsea's Loan Market Maneuverings

Elsewhere, Chelsea's movement in the transfer market continues as midfielder Andrey Santos, aged 19, sets out on loan to Strasbourg. Prior to this, Santos had a stint at Nottingham Forest, where he made a modest two appearances.

Chelsea's decision to recall Santos earlier this month has paved the way for a subsequent loan to Strasbourg. The French club's connection to Chelsea is strengthened further by its ownership; Todd Boehly and Behdad Egbahli, co-owners of Chelsea, acquired a major stake in Strasbourg in June 2023. This shared ownership potentially benefits both clubs in terms of player development and strategic cooperation.
